Many Middle Eastern countries have been transitioning from largely rural living to urban living. City populations are growing quickly as people move to find jobs. However, environmental problems have come with this rapid urbanization. Many urban areas are experiencing air and water pollution. Air pollution is occurring due to the region's reliance on toxic energy sources, oil and gas. Oil and gas release emissions into the air when consumed by factories or cars. Cities are also experiencing water pollution issues due to a lack of waste treatment options. Without places to dispose of waste, people are dumping sewage and industrial waste into water sources. Finally, urban coastal areas are having problems with coastal degradation. Soil erodes and wildlife habitats are destroyed as land is changed for urban development.

-Non-rapid eye movement sleep is dreamless sleep. During NREM, the brain waves on the electroencephalographic (EEG) recording are typically slow and of high voltage, the breathing and heart rate are slow and regular, the blood pressure is low, and the sleeper is relatively still.

-NREM-2 occurs after NREM-1, an individual relaxes more fully and has about 20 minutes of NREM-2. It is characterized by its periodic sleep spindles, or bursts of rapid, rhythmic brain-wave activity. About half the night is spent in this phase.
